Anatoly Baratynsky was a Russian painter born in Ufa, Russia in 1962. He graduated from the Magnitogorsk Pedagogical Institute, Art Department, Russia in 1988. Unfortunately, he passed away in 1988, leaving behind a legacy of his artwork.
